    Heifer International's mission is to work with communities to end world hunger and poverty and to care for the Earth. Dan West was a farmer from the American Midwest and member of the Church of the Brethren who went to the front lines of the Spanish Civil War as an aid worker.     Business Development Operations Manager - Africa

    Function

    As the Business Development Operations Manager, the role plays a crucial role in partnering with stakeholders at Heifer, including business development and operations in the Africa regional office.

    The role holder provides support operations related to business development and partnership, which includes managing schedules, coordinating with the BD department senior director, and working with sub-regional BD and partnership directors for specific assignments in information management for the Heifer Africa pipeline. Coordinates with country offices in entering project ideas as opportunities into the PFID and accomplishes other related activities as advised by the Senior BD and P Director. Coordinates work with sub-regional BD directors to ensure successful business development operations management for each opportunity in design and co-design areas in Africa. Where necessary and required, coordinates and collaborates with PFID Coordinator/Valenya for support and alignment. This may include managing workflow in PFID projects information management in coordination with the Senior Business Development Director.

    A key aspect of this role involves fine-tuning processes and procedures to optimize efficiency and effectiveness. Additionally, you will collaborate with other leaders across the region and countries in the organization to develop and implement solutions to complex challenges. Your contribution will be instrumental in supporting the business development operational requirements and BD processes such as scheduling virtual meetings in Africa and with HQ; ensuring Signature programs checklists are completed by the respective country director and reviewed by the Senior BD and P Director; maintaining strategic focus while also providing tactical support to the team.

    This role will be based in either Kenya, Rwanda, Tanzania, Uganda, Ethiopia, Malawi, Senegal or Nigeria.  

    Business Development Support (60%) 

    • Provide support to the business development team in Heifer Africa in setting meeting times and schedules and coordinating with regional teams and the Business Development and Partnership Team.
    • Provide business development and partnership operations management requirements as directed and advised by the Senior BD & P Director Africa.
    • Engage and provide critical support for the execution of the Africa BD department processes.
    • Support sharing lessons across the department on risk mitigation and best practices in the BD process.
    • Work and coordinate with PFID coordinators in the HQ for alignment and ensure that all Africa opportunities are captured in Heifer’s PFID system, once Signature Programme checklists are approved by the SVP.

    Contract Management (20%)

    •  In coordination and consultation with the Senior Programmes Operations Director, oversee the development and execution of business operations to ensure they meet Heifer International BD policies and requirements.
    • Coordinate with country directors in the respective country programmes at the Heifer Africa region, including capacity building and training for country programmes' relevant teams for efficient and effective BD and partnership operations management processes.
    • Implement and manage BD operations and BD contract management tools, systems, and procedures to streamline BD operations and enhance productivity.
    • Analyze BD processes execution and BD performance to provide strategic recommendations and optimize business development opportunities.
    • Collate BD risk mitigation action plans in the BD department, including the sub-regional risk mitigation plans, and ensure BD risk mitigation action quarterly reports are produced.

    Collaboration and Coordination (15%) 

    • Collaborate with various Heifer internal departments, such as Africa’s Contract Specialist, legal, finance, and procurement, to align BD processes and agreement documents and contracts with the organization’s strategies and risk management policies.

    Other Duties (5%)

    • Perform any other related duties as assigned by the Senior Business Development and Partnership Director – Africa Programs.

    Minimum Requirements 

    • Bachelor’s degree with a minimum of 7 years of relevant experience.
    • Proven experience working with non-Federal clients, including state and local agencies, as well as philanthropic organizations for funding.

    Preferred Requirements 

    • A relevant postgraduate degree, such as an MBA, is desirable.
    •  Exceptional communication and presentation skills.
    • Ability to work effectively under pressure and manage tight deadlines.

    Essential Job Functions and Physical Demands 

    • Ability to work under pressure, perform multiple tasks, manage consistently competing priorities, and be comfortable in a rapidly changing environment.
    • Excellent interpersonal skills with the ability to work cooperatively, tactfully, strategically, and diplomatically with a culturally diverse group of people.
    • Ability to work in a highly matrixed environment and deliver through others.
    • Ability to maintain close relationships and work with team members from a distance with limited opportunities for personal interaction.
    • Constant face-to-face, electronic, and telephone communication with colleagues and the general public.
    • Willingness and ability to work with a flexible schedule and outside of normal business hours.
    • Ability and willingness to travel extensively, both domestically and internationally.
    • Ability to work with sensitive information and maintain confidentiality.
